📄 bootrom.map
字号:
Archive member included because of file (symbol)
romExtras.a(sysAUtils.o) romInit.o (sysClearSPRGs)
romExtras.a(sysUtils.o) romInit.o (sdraminit)
D:\Tornado221PPC\target/lib/ppc/PPC603/common/libos.a(copyright.o)
romInit.o (copyright_wind_river)
D:\Tornado221PPC\target/lib/ppc/PPC603/common/libos.a(inflateLib.o)
bootInit.o (inflate)
Memory Configuration
Name Origin Length Attributes
*default* 0x00000000 0xffffffff
Linker script and memory map
Address of section .text set to 0x100000
LOAD romInit.o
LOAD bootInit.o
LOAD version.o
LOAD bootrom.Z.o
START GROUP
LOAD romExtras.a
LOAD D:\Tornado221PPC\target/lib/ppc/PPC603/gnu/libcplus.a
LOAD D:\Tornado221PPC\target/lib/ppc/PPC603/gnu/libgnucplus.a
LOAD D:\Tornado221PPC\target/lib/ppc/PPC603/gnu/libvxcom.a
LOAD D:\Tornado221PPC\target/lib/ppc/PPC603/common/libarch.a
LOAD D:\Tornado221PPC\target/lib/ppc/PPC603/common/libcommoncc.a
LOAD D:\Tornado221PPC\target/lib/ppc/PPC603/common/libdcc.a
LOAD D:\Tornado221PPC\target/lib/ppc/PPC603/common/libdrv.a
LOAD D:\Tornado221PPC\target/lib/ppc/PPC603/common/libgcc.a
LOAD D:\Tornado221PPC\target/lib/ppc/PPC603/common/libnet.a
LOAD D:\Tornado221PPC\target/lib/ppc/PPC603/common/libos.a
LOAD D:\Tornado221PPC\target/lib/ppc/PPC603/common/librpc.a
LOAD D:\Tornado221PPC\target/lib/ppc/PPC603/common/libtffs.a
LOAD D:\Tornado221PPC\target/lib/ppc/PPC603/common/libusb.a
LOAD D:\Tornado221PPC\target/lib/ppc/PPC603/common/libvxfusion.a
LOAD D:\Tornado221PPC\target/lib/ppc/PPC603/common/libvxmp.a
LOAD D:\Tornado221PPC\target/lib/ppc/PPC603/common/libwdb.a
LOAD D:\Tornado221PPC\target/lib/ppc/PPC603/common/libwind.a
LOAD D:\Tornado221PPC\target/lib/ppc/PPC603/common/libwindview.a
LOAD D:\Tornado221PPC\target/lib/libPPC603gnuvx.a
END GROUP
.text 0x00100000 0x4620
0x00100000 wrs_kernel_text_start=.
0x00100000 _wrs_kernel_text_start=.
*(.text)
.text 0x00100000 0x318 romInit.o
0x00100100 romInit
0x00100100 _romInit
.text 0x00100318 0x1ec bootInit.o
0x00100318 romStart
.text 0x00100504 0x2c8 romExtras.a(sysAUtils.o)
0x00100538 sysClearSRs
0x001007ac sysAbs
0x001005c4 sysClearIBATs
0x00100504 sysClearSPRGs
0x00100684 sysClearFPRegs
0x00100610 sysClearDBATs
0x00100524 sysClearMSR
0x001007c4 sysDecSet
0x00100760 sysMulDiv64
0x001007bc sysDecGet
.text 0x001007cc 0x4c8 romExtras.a(sysUtils.o)
0x001008f0 sysVcoFreqGet
0x0010082c sysCpmFreqGet
0x00100b68 SetLight1
0x001008cc sysSccFreqGet
0x00100a64 sdraminit
0x0010087c sysBusFreqGet
0x00100bf8 LightDown
0x00100a44 FillSDRAM
0x00100980 sysMsDelay
0x00100c7c Mydelay
0x00100a20 sysDelay
0x00100bc8 SetLight3
0x00100c58 InitLight
0x00100b98 SetLight2
0x00100c28 LightUp
0x00100914 sysUsDelay
0x00100b38 SetLight0
0x001007cc sysBaudClkFreq
.text 0x00100c94 0x3660 D:\Tornado221PPC\target/lib/ppc/PPC603/common/libos.a(inflateLib.o)
0x001041a4 inflate
*(.text.*)
*(.stub)
*(.gnu.warning)
*(.gnu.linkonce.t*)
*(.init)
*(.fini)
*(.glue_7t)
*(.glue_7)
*(.rdata)
*(.mips16.fn.*)
*(.mips16.call.*)
*(.reginfo)
*(.rodata)
.rodata 0x001042f4 0x38 version.o
.rodata 0x0010432c 0xa4 D:\Tornado221PPC\target/lib/ppc/PPC603/common/libos.a(copyright.o)
0x0010432c copyright_wind_river
.rodata 0x001043d0 0x250 D:\Tornado221PPC\target/lib/ppc/PPC603/common/libos.a(inflateLib.o)
*(.rodata.*)
*(.gnu.linkonce.r*)
*(.rodata1)
*(.sdata2)
*(.sbss2)
0x00104620 .=ALIGN(0x10)
0x00104620 .=ALIGN(0x10)
0x00104620 wrs_kernel_text_end=.
0x00104620 _wrs_kernel_text_end=.
0x00104620 etext=.
0x00104620 _etext=.
.data 0x00104620 0x31930
0x00104620 wrs_kernel_data_start=.
0x00104620 _wrs_kernel_data_start=.
*(.data)
.data 0x00104620 0x4 romInit.o
.data 0x00104624 0x10 version.o
0x00104628 runtimeVersion
0x00104630 creationDate
0x00104624 runtimeName
0x0010462c vxWorksVersion
.data 0x00104634 0x3167c bootrom.Z.o
0x00135cb0 _binArrayEnd
0x00104634 _binArrayStart
0x00135cb0 binArrayEnd
0x00104634 binArrayStart
.data 0x00135cb0 0x29c D:\Tornado221PPC\target/lib/ppc/PPC603/common/libos.a(inflateLib.o)
0x00135f48 inflateCksum
*(.data.*)
*(.gnu.linkonce.d*)
*(.data1)
*(.eh_frame)
*(.gcc_except_table)
*crtbegin.o(.ctors)
EXCLUDE_FILE ( *crtend.o)*(.ctors)
*(SORT(.ctors.*))
*(.ctors)
*crtbegin.o(.dtors)
EXCLUDE_FILE ( *crtend.o)*(.dtors)
*(SORT(.dtors.*))
*(.dtors)
0x0013df40 _gp=(ALIGN(0x10)+0x7ff0)
*(.got.plt)
*(.got)
*(.dynamic)
*(.got2)
*(.sdata)
*(.sdata.*)
*(.lit8)
*(.lit4)
*fill* 0x00135f4c 0x4
0x00135f50 .=ALIGN(0x10)
0x00135f50 .=ALIGN(0x10)
0x00135f50 edata=.
0x00135f50 _edata=.
0x00135f50 wrs_kernel_data_end=.
0x00135f50 _wrs_kernel_data_end=.
.bss 0x00135f50 0x19c80
0x00135f50 wrs_kernel_bss_start=.
0x00135f50 _wrs_kernel_bss_start=.
*(.sbss)
*(.scommon)
*(.dynbss)
*(.bss)
.bss 0x00135f50 0x19c74 D:\Tornado221PPC\target/lib/ppc/PPC603/common/libos.a(inflateLib.o)
*(COMMON)
*fill* 0x0014fbc4 0xc
0x0014fbd0 .=ALIGN(0x10)
0x0014fbd0 .=ALIGN(0x10)
0x0014fbd0 end=.
0x0014fbd0 _end=.
0x0014fbd0 wrs_kernel_bss_end=.
0x0014fbd0 _wrs_kernel_bss_end=.
/DISCARD/
*(.note)
*(.comment)
*(.pdr)
.stab
*(.stab)
.stabstr
*(.stabstr)
.stab.excl
*(.stab.excl)
.stab.exclstr
*(.stab.exclstr)
.stab.index
*(.stab.index)
.stab.indexstr
*(.stab.indexstr)
.comment
*(.comment)
.debug
*(.debug)
.line
*(.line)
.debug_srcinfo
*(.debug_srcinfo)
.debug_sfnames
*(.debug_sfnames)
.debug_aranges
*(.debug_aranges)
.debug_pubnames
*(.debug_pubnames)
.debug_info
*(.debug_info)
.debug_abbrev
*(.debug_abbrev)
.debug_line
*(.debug_line)
.debug_frame
*(.debug_frame)
.debug_str
*(.debug_str)
.debug_loc
*(.debug_loc)
.debug_macinfo
*(.debug_macinfo)
.debug_weaknames
*(.debug_weaknames)
.debug_funcnames
*(.debug_funcnames)
.debug_typenames
*(.debug_typenames)
.debug_varnames
*(.debug_varnames)
OUTPUT(bootrom elf32-powerpc)
⌨️ 快捷键说明
复制代码
Ctrl + C
搜索代码
Ctrl + F
全屏模式
F11
切换主题
Ctrl + Shift + D
显示快捷键
?
增大字号
Ctrl + =
减小字号
Ctrl + -